Historically significant and enhanced with exceptional custom updates, 6411 33rd Street Northwest is a distinguished 1917 Sears Roebuck House, catalog No. C251, designated by the Chevy Chase Historical Society and built by John S. DeForest. Located in the sought-after Chevy Chase neighborhood, offering a community feel with all the benefits of living in the nation's capital - easy access to renowned dining, shopping, nightlife, theaters, parkland, and more! A defining feature of the residence is the thoughtful architectural work completed by the award-winning McInturff Architects, including the kitchen expansion, the dramatic great room addition, and the main level bathroom addition. These improvements bring light, scale, and artistry to the home while respecting its historic character.
